53 QUEEN MARY AVENUE is a midsized detached house of 110m², built sometime between 1930 and 1949. It was last sold for £200,000 in April 2003, which was around 23% below the average April 2003 detached price in the Bournemouth Christchurch and Poole local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was July 2012, where the current energy rating was E, and the potential energy rating was C.

53 QUEEN MARY AVENUE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Bournemouth Christchurch and Poole local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 53 QUEEN MARY AVENUE sales from January 1997 and April 2003 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the January 1997 sale was for 17%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 17% below the HPI over time, until the April 2003 sale, where it falls to 23%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 23% below the HPI.

53 QUEEN MARY AVENUE: Plot and Title Map

53 QUEEN MARY AVENUE sits on a plot of roughly 0.081 of an acre, or 329m². The below map shows the location of 53 QUEEN MARY AVENUE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 53 QUEEN MARY AVENUE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
